1942 in Canadian football

{{Year nav sports topic5|1942|Canadian football|sports}}

With Canadians serving on battlefields across Europe and the Pacific, the first ever non-civilian Grey Cup took place in 1942. The Toronto RCAF Hurricanes defeated the Winnipeg RCAF Bombers on an icy field at Varsity Stadium in Toronto.{{Cite web|url=https://www.cfl.ca/2005/11/04/grey_cup_memories__1942/|title=Grey Cup Memories: 1942|date=2005-11-04|website=CFL.ca|language=en|access-date=2019-10-05}}

Canadian Football News in 1942

The WIFU and the IRFU suspended operations for the duration of World War II. A couple of military teams based in Toronto, the RCAF Hurricanes and the Navy York Bulldogs joined the regular ORFU teams like Balmy Beach and the Toronto Indians.  The Ottawa Rough Riders continued operation, but as part of an Ottawa based league. Out West, a three team Winnipeg city league was formed with the Winnipeg Bombers, the University of Manitoba Bisons and a military team called the RCAF Flyers.{{Cite web|url=https://www.cflapedia.com/Years/1942.html|title=1942|website=www.cflapedia.com|access-date=2019-10-12}}
